> > I am still working on transferring from an old computer (Beige) to a > newer 450mhz G4. > > I have an Encore Zif upgrade in the Beige that should also work in > the G4. > > Does that mean that I can take the ZIF from the (I hope I have the > terminology correct) G4 and put it in the Beige? > > My ZIF upgrade is 500mhz. If the G4 you have is a Yikes, aka pci graphics, then, yes, the processors are swappable. If your G4 is is a Sawtooth, (with agp graphics) then, no, the processors are not swappable. According to MacTracker, the fastest Yikes was a 400 MHz. So unless you have a Yikes with an upgraded processor, the odds are that the processors are NOT swappable.
